If you take one thing from any nylon guide, take this: nylon must be bone-dry, and it does not stay that way on its own. More failed nylon prints come from moisture than from every other cause combined.
Why nylon and water don’t mix
Nylon is intensely hygroscopic — it pulls water vapour straight out of the air. When that moisture reaches the melt zone it flashes to steam, blowing bubbles in the extrudate. The result is popping and hissing while printing, a rough foamy surface, stringing, and — worst of all — badly weakened layers. A spool that felt fine yesterday can be too wet to print today after a humid night.
How to dry nylon properly
Dry nylon hot and long:
- Temperature: 70–80°C in a filament dryer or oven.
- Time: 6–12 hours for a normal spool; longer if it has been exposed.
- After drying: store sealed with fresh desiccant immediately — it re-absorbs within hours of being out.
A cheap filament dryer that only reaches 50°C is not enough to fully dry nylon; it can maintain a dry spool but struggles to rescue a soaked one. An oven or a dryer rated to 70°C+ does the real work.
Print from a heated dry box
Because nylon re-absorbs moisture so fast, the professional habit is not to “dry it once” but to print directly from a heated dry box — an enclosed container with a dryer or desiccant that feeds the printer through a PTFE tube. On a long nylon print, a spool left in open air can pick up enough moisture partway through to ruin the top of the part. Keeping it in a dry box the whole time is the reliable fix.
